About this experience
For wine lovers who want to get insider knowledge of the South African wine industry or just enjoy the amazing Cape Winelands. This is a private day tour with a specialist wine guide that you can design by choosing four wine estates in the Stellenbosch/Franschhoek/Paarl area for wine tastings, or we provide a customised itinerary to you.

Another great wine tasting tour with Marlene
Second time doing a wine tour with Marlene. Both tours were an incredible experience. High quality clean vehicles, and Marlene is very knowledgeable when it comes to the local wine estates and will customize a tour to your liking. Highly recommend. Will hopefully be back for another tour with Marlene soon!

Best of the best! So glad we chose this tour.
We highly recommend this tour. Cedric, the owner, and our guide for the day, was excellent. He tailored our visits to our wine preferences and made suggestions enroute based on our feedback. His knowledge of wine and all the wineries is exceptional, and every visit was seamless. We arrived and could immediately do the tasting without any waiting. Be prepared for great wine and mind blowing scenery if you let him guide your day.
